  • You won't become more successful until you become more delusional
    Your tendency to be realistic is robbing you of the future you deserve. From girlhood, most of us have been discouraged from being "too" ambitious because it violates the traditional trajectory of a woman's life: go to school, get a job, get married, become a mother, retire, die. Rinse & repeat in the next life.Babes, true delusion is accepting a life someone else decided was “right” for you.You know how many people told me I'm delusional, unrealistic, and crazy for wanting to quit my corporate job to start a podcast? Plenty. If I'd listened to them, you wouldn't be about to press play to listen to me.Deviating from the status quo will get you backlash and side eye, but that doesn't mean you're doing anything wrong.   • Girly law of power #28: Act spoiled & watch the world bend to your will
    Spoiled girls get whatever they want, while low maintenance girls get what they're given. There's absolutely nothing wrong with being spoiled — a spoiled woman is simply someone with a high sense of worth, who knows what she wants, and never settles for less.Acting spoiled is a huge patriarchy hack we tend to overlook, because we're brainwashed to think it's bad to be spoiled.
